Some years ago, I read somewhere that the so-called Narvik-class destroyers Z 23 - Z 30 were each given tradition-names in honor of the destroyers lost in the 1940 Battles of Narvik. Some examples of these names were given in the article, but all I recall is that "Georg Thiele" was one of the names passed on to a "Narvik." Has anybody heard or read anything about this?

The names were offical.
Small ships up to destroyer size could be named after crews or officers of ships with special merits. Such as
Wilhelm Heidkamp - the guy who saved Seydlitz during the Doggerbank battle
Georg Thiele was captain of torpedoboat S 119 and died in a battle in 1914.

In my opinion you are thinking about the fact, that the new destroyers beginning with Z 23 have to keep up the tradition of the already lost boats, f.e. Z 24 for Z 2 GEORG THIELE or Z 25 for Z 18 HANS LÜDEMANN.
